
Fani Willis Calls Nathan Wade ‘Brave’ as She Accepts His Resignation From Georgia Trump Case
Fulton County District Attorney Fani Willis has accepted the resignation of lead prosecutor Nathan Wade, with whom she was having an affair, calling him “brave” for taking on a high-profile case against former President Donald Trump and 14 codefendants. In a letter to Mr. Wade on Friday, Ms. Willis accepted his resignation “effective immediately.” “I will always remember—and will remind everyone—that you were brave enough to step forward and take on the investigation and prosecution of the allegations that the defendants in this case engaged in a conspiracy to overturn Georgia’s 2020 Presidential Election,” Ms. Willis wrote. Mr. Wade resigned “effective immediately” on Friday, hours after Fulton County Superior Court Judge Scott McAfee ruled that Ms. Willis does not need to step down from prosecuting the case if the special prosecutor at the center of allegations over his affair with the district attorney is removed....
